המונח 'שרשור' פירושו פשוט קישור או חיבור של דברים יחד. ב-Microsoft Excel, הפונקציה CONCATENATE או CONCAT משמשת לחיבור שני או יותר נתונים של תאים/עמודות יחד.
ישנן שתי שיטות לשילוב הנתונים באקסל:
- שימוש בפונקציית CONCATENATE/CONCAT
- שימוש באופרטור '&'
במאמר זה, נראה לך כיצד לשלב מספר תאים למחרוזת אחת באמצעות הפונקציה Concatenate ב-Excel.
שילוב תאים באמצעות הפונקציה CONCATENATE/CONCAT
הפונקציה CONCATENATE היא אחת מפונקציות הטקסט של Excel המסייעות לך לשלב שני תאים או יותר למחרוזת אחת, בין אם הם מכילים מספרים, תאריכים או מחרוזות טקסט.
מ-Excel 2016 ואילך, Excel החליף את 'CONCATENATE' בפונקציה 'CONCAT'. כלומר, בגירסאות מאוחרות יותר של Excel, אתה יכול להשתמש ב-'CONCATENATE' או 'CONCAT', אבל בגרסאות ישנות יותר של Excel (2013 ומטה), אתה יכול להשתמש רק בפונקציה 'CONCATENATE'.
תחביר
התחביר עבור הפונקציה CONCAT באקסל הוא:
=CONCAT(text1, text2, ... text_n)
עבור Microsoft Excel 2013 ומעלה, התחביר הוא:
=CONCATENATE(text1, text2, ... text_n)
טיעונים
text1, text2, … text_n - הערכים שברצונך לחבר יחד, ערכים אלה יכולים להיות מחרוזות, תאים או טווחי תאים.
שרשרת מחרוזות טקסט
ניתן לחבר שתי מחרוזות טקסט או יותר למחרוזת אחת עם פונקציית CONCAT.
כדי לשרשר, ראשית, בחר את התא שבו אתה רוצה את התוצאה, והזן את הנוסחה. אם אתה משתמש ישירות במחרוזת טקסט כארגומנטים בפונקציה, הקפד לתחום אותם במרכאות כפולות ("") כפי שמוצג להלן.
שרשרת ערכי תאים
הנוסחה של CONCAT לשרשרת ערכי תאים A1 ו-B1 היא:
=CONCAT(A1,A2)
הוסף הפניות לתאים כארגומנטים בנוסחה כדי להצטרף לערכי התא.
שרשור שני ערכי תאים עם מפריד
כדי להפריד את הערכים עם רווח, הזן " " בין הפניות לתאים.
=CONCAT(A1," ",B1)
הזן רווח (" ") מוקף במרכאות כפולות בארגומנט השני כפי שמוצג להלן.
שרשור תאים עם תווים מיוחדים
ניתן גם לשרשר ערכים עם תוחמים שונים כגון פסיקים, רווחים, סימני פיסוק שונים או תווים אחרים כגון מקף או קו נטוי.
כדי לשלב שני תאים עם פסיק:
=CONCAT(A1,",",B1)
כאשר אתה מזין מפריד (,) הקפד לתחום אותם במרכאות כפולות.
שרשרת מחרוזת טקסט וערכי תא
הפונקציה CONCAT למטה מצטרפת למחרוזת בתא A1, למחרוזת 'and' ולמחרוזת בתא B1.
=CONCAT(A1," ו", B1)
הוספנו רווח לפני ואחרי המילה " ו" בארגומנט השני של הנוסחה כדי להפריד בין המחרוזות המשורשרות וגם כדי להוסיף משמעות למחרוזת הטקסט.
אתה יכול להוסיף מחרוזת טקסט בכל ארגומנט של הנוסחה CONCAT/CONCATENATE שלך.
שרשרת עמודות באקסל
נניח שיש לך רשימה של שמות פרטיים ושמות משפחה בשתי עמודות נפרדות ואתה רוצה להצטרף אליהם כדי ליצור עמודה אחת של שמות מלאים. כדי לשרשר שתי עמודות או יותר, הקלד נוסחת שרשור בתא הראשון ולאחר מכן החל אותה על העמודה כולה על ידי גרירת ידית המילוי.
כדי להעתיק את הנוסחה לתאים אחרים, פשוט גרור את הריבוע הקטן (ידית המילוי) בפינה הימנית התחתונה של התא שנבחר.
עכשיו, יש לך עמודה של שמות מלאים.
שרשרת טווח של מיתרים
אתה יכול גם להצטרף למגוון של מחרוזות באמצעות הפונקציה CONCAT. אם אינך רוצה להוסיף מפריד בין המחרוזת (רווח, פסיק, מקף וכו'), הנוסחה הזו יכולה להיות שימושית:
=CONCAT(A1:F1)
אם ברצונך להצטרף לטווח של מחרוזות עם מפריד (" "), השתמש בנוסחה הבאה:
=CONCAT(A2," ",B2," ",C2," ",D2," ",E2)
שרשרת טווח של מחרוזות באמצעות הפונקציה TEXTJOIN
הפונקציה TEXTJOIN היא גם פונקציה נוספת שבה אתה יכול להשתמש כדי להצטרף לטווח של נתוני תאים. הפונקציה TEXTJOIN משרשרת (משלבת) את הערכים ממספר טווחים ו/או מחרוזות עם מפריד נתון. שלא כמו הפונקציה CONCAT, TEXTJOIN מאפשר לך להגדיר אם להתעלם מערכים ריקים או לא.
=TEXTJOIN(" ",TRUE,A2:E2)
נוסחה זו מצטרפת לטווח של מחרוזות עם מפריד (שאותו תציין בארגומנט הראשון) בין כל ערך. נוסחה זו מתעלמת מתאים ריקים מכיוון שהארגומנט השני שלה מוגדר ל'TRUE'.
אתה יכול להשתמש בפונקציה TEXTJOIN רק ב-Excel 2016 או גירסה מאוחרת יותר.
שרשור באמצעות '&' אופרטור
אופרטור '&' הוא דרך נוספת לשלב מחרוזות טקסט ותאים ב- Microsoft Excel. האופרטור אמפרסנד (&) הוא למעשה חלופה לפונקציה CONCATENATE.
נוסחאות האמפרסנד (&) הן קצרות, פשוטות וקלות לשימוש.
תחביר
=cell_1&cell_2
השתמש באופרטור & כדי לשלב את הערכים של התאים A1 ו-B1:
=A1&B1
בחר תא שבו אתה רוצה את התוצאה והקלד את הנוסחה לעיל.
שרשור שני ערכי תאים עם מפריד באמצעות אופרטור '&'
כדי לשרשר את הערכים בתא A1 ובתא B1, ורווח ביניהם באמצעות האופרטור '&':
=A1&" "&B1
דוגמה נוספת עם תוחם נוסף:
שרשרת מחרוזת טקסט וערכי תא באמצעות אופרטור '&'
אתה יכול גם להשתמש באופרטור '&' כדי לחבר את המחרוזת בתא A1, את הטקסט 'ו' שביניהם, והמחרוזת בתא B1.
=A1&" ו-"&B1
הוספנו רווח לפני ואחרי המילה " ו" כדי להפריד בין מחרוזות הטקסט המשורשרות. תחום תמיד את הטקסט במרכאות כפולות בנוסחת Excel.
CONCAT לעומת אופרטור '&'
ההבדל האמיתי היחיד בין אופרטורים CONCAT ו-"&" הוא שלפונקציית Excel CONCAT יש מגבלה של 255 מחרוזות ואין מגבלות כאלה עבור האמפרסנד.
כך אתה משרשר מחרוזות באקסל.